#2f7f9e basic color information

#2f7f9e

In the RGB color model, hex triplet #2f7f9e has decimal index of: 3112862, is composed of 18.4% red, 49.8% green and 62% blue. #2f7f9e in CMYK color model, is composed of 70.3% cyan, 19.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 38% black.
#336699 is the closest web-safe color to #2f7f9e.
